Skip to content

An all-in-one Subathon Manager for Twitch. Manage your timer and goals overlay, settings, and more all locally!

License

Notifications You must be signed in to change notification settings

WolfwithSword/SubathonManager

Repository files navigation

SubathonManager

GitHub Actions Workflow Status GitHub Downloads (all assets, all releases) GitHub Issues or Pull Requests

GitHub Release Date GitHub Release

Static Badge Static Badge

icon



Subathon Manager
An all-in-one Subathon/Donothon Manager for Twitch and YouTube. Manage your timer, goals, overlays, settings, and more — all locally.


Supported Integrations

  • Twitch
    • Cheers/Bits
      • Including Combos & Powerups
    • Follows, Raids
    • Subs & Gift Subs
    • Charity Donations
    • Chat Commands
    • Auto lock/pause on stream end
    • Auto unlock/resume on stream start
    • Hype Trains
      • Events and optional multiplier trigger
  • Youtube
    • SuperChats
    • Memberships & Gift Memberships
      • Due to limitations, we treat all memberships as a single level/tier
    • Chat Commands
  • KoFi
    • Tips & Memberships (via StreamerBot)
  • StreamElements
    • SE Pay Tips
  • StreamLabs
    • Donations
  • Blerp
    • Twitch & YouTube, (Bits & Beets)
  • External
    • Custom commands, donations, and subscriptions via POST API

Features

  • Currency conversions for donations/tips/superchats using daily floating rates
  • Points or Donation (Donothon-style) based goals
  • Audit & Event logging to file and Discord webhooks
  • Built in overlay editor and host server for local html widgets
  • Goals list tracking
  • Multiplier modes for time and/or points
  • External control API for integrating with complex setups and unsupported services
  • Reverse Subathon - timer goes up, events reduce time!
  • Remote config value management
  • And more!

License

We use a modified MIT License that only prohibits the software from being sold or redistributed commercially, or offered as or part of a commercial service.

You are fully permitted to use the software for commercial purposes such as streaming, or developing widget assets for sale. Modifications are allowed, provided they retain this license, though contributions back are preferred!

In private, you can do whatever you want. This software is as open-source as possible with that single restriction, as its sole purpose is to prevent users from being taken advantage of from commercial distributions/derivatives of this otherwise open and free software.

Contact

For questions, issues, or other, you can leave an issue or discussion here in the repo.

Alternatively, you can contact me through Discord.

About

An all-in-one Subathon Manager for Twitch. Manage your timer and goals overlay, settings, and more all locally!

Resources

License

Stars

Watchers

Forks

Packages

No packages published